Commentaire dans cellule a l'aide d'un textbox

  • Initiateur de la discussion Initiateur de la discussion yves03
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

yves03

XLDnaute Occasionnel
Bonjour à tous,
Je souhaiterais pouvoir recuperer la valeur d'un textbox et l'inserer en commentaire d'une cellule. et j'ai un soucis
J'arrive a ecrire un commentaire avec un texte fixe a l'aide d'une macro, mais je n'arrive pas a recuperer la valeur d'un textbox.
Si quelqu'un peut m'aider;
Merci d'avance
 
Re : Commentaire dans cellule a l'aide d'un textbox

Bonjour Yves

regarde le code ci-dessous, suppose un textbox de la barre d'outils "boites à outils contrôles" placé sur la feuille 1, nom feuille et textbox à adapter :

Code:
Sub test()
Dim c As Comment
With Range("A1")
    Set c = .Comment
    If Not c Is Nothing Then c.Delete
    .AddComment Feuil1.TextBox1.Value
End With
End Sub

bon après midi
@+
 
Re : Commentaire dans cellule a l'aide d'un textbox

Bonjour Yves

regarde le code ci-dessous, suppose un textbox de la barre d'outils "boites à outils contrôles" placé sur la feuille 1, nom feuille et textbox à adapter :

Code:
Sub test()
Dim c As Comment
With Range("A1")
    Set c = .Comment
    If Not c Is Nothing Then c.Delete
    .AddComment Feuil1.TextBox1.Value
End With
End Sub

bon après midi
@+


J'ai modifie le code car mon textbox est dans un userform qui s'appelle NDF, mais j'ai une erreur sur cette ligne

.Addcomment NDF.Textbox1.Value

Code:
Dim c As Comment
With Range("A1")
    Set c = .Comment
    If Not c Is Nothing Then c.Delete
    .AddComment NDF.TextBox1.Value
End With
End Sub

Merci de ton aide
 
Re : Commentaire dans cellule a l'aide d'un textbox

Re

si NDF est le nom de ton usf, cela devrait fonctionner, je vien de tester chez moi, et cela marche (excel2003), le commentaire se positionne bien sur la cellule A1 de la feuille active...
@+
 
Re : Commentaire dans cellule a l'aide d'un textbox

Re

si c'est pour la cellule active, modifies le code comme suit :

Code:
Dim c As Comment
With ActiveCell
    Set c = .Comment
    If Not c Is Nothing Then c.Delete
    .AddComment NDF.TextBox1.Value
End With
End Sub

@+
 
Re : Commentaire dans cellule a l'aide d'un textbox

J'ai encore un probleme ça ne fonctionne bien que lorsque je selectionne le bouton radio 0 dans mon userform, lorsque je selectionne le 1 ça ne fonctionne plus, j'avais aussi essaye avec les autres et cà ne fonctionnait pas.
Je joint le fichier
Merci d'avance
 

Pièces jointes

-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D

Discussions similaires

Retour